UC Irvine students decry evolution-only science, sponsor intelligent design talk - October 8, 2013

A lecture on October 2, 2013 at UC Irvine by the IDEA Center's Casey Luskin has been covered in The College Fix. The article, titled "UC Irvine students decry evolution-only science, sponsor intelligent design talk," positively covers academic freedom for intelligent design: Citing a lack of classroom discourse on intelligent design at the University of California Irvine – a highly regarded scientific research institution – a Christian student group recently brought in a scholar to discuss the merits of the controversial theory, which suggests an intelligence can be found in the blueprints of life.

“Intelligent design is a valid explanation that should be able to be freely taught on a scientific campus,” UC Irvine biomedical engineering major Daryl Arreza, 23, told The College Fix.

The pro-intelligent design scholar who spoke at UC Irvine on Wednesday at the behest of a Ratio Christi told the audience that – despite what they may have heard to the contrary in many of their science classes – scientifically vetted evidence does indeed support the theory that life on Earth had help evolving.
